Readability and Best Practices

One common concern with handwritten fonts is readability. Will customers be able to read it on a small mobile screen? Will it hold up on a tiny product label? Twilight Sonata is designed with these practical considerations in mind, but smart usage is still required. As a general rule, reserve this font for headlines, logos, and short accents. Avoid using it for long paragraphs of text, such as product descriptions or terms of service.

For example, if you are designing a café menu, use Twilight Sonata for the category headers like "Pastries" or "Specialty Coffees." Then, pair it with a clean, simple sans serif font for the item descriptions and prices. This hierarchy ensures that the design remains beautiful without sacrificing functionality. Always test your designs at different sizes. Print a sample label or view your social media graphic on a phone to ensure the letters do not blend together.

Font Pairing Ideas for a Professional Look

To get the most out of your design assets, you need to know how to pair fonts effectively. Twilight Sonata is versatile enough to work with several styles, but some combinations yield better results than others.

  1. Pair with a Clean Sans Serif: This is the safest and most modern approach. A geometric sans serif provides a neutral background that lets the whimsical nature of Twilight Sonata stand out. This combination is ideal for tech startups, modern boutiques, and minimalist brands.
  2. Pair with a Classic Serif: If your brand leans more towards tradition, luxury, or academia, pairing this script with a refined serif font creates a sophisticated, editorial look. This works well for wedding planners, high-end consultants, or literary cafes.
  3. Use Within the Duo: Since Twilight Sonata is a font duo, it likely includes complementary weights or styles. Using both elements from the same family ensures perfect harmony and reduces the cognitive load on your viewer.

Licensing and Commercial Use

Finally, always verify the licensing terms before using any commercial font in your business. Different licenses cover different uses. Some allow digital use only, while others permit physical product sales, such as printing the font on mugs, t-shirts, or product labels. Since Twilight Sonata is aimed at creators and entrepreneurs, it is essential to check the specific agreement provided by Script Amp or the font creator. Ensuring you have the correct license protects your business from legal issues and supports the designers who create these valuable tools.
